### Ingredients You’ll Need:
– **1-inch piece of fresh ginger root**: Fresh ginger is best for its potent medicinal properties.
– **2 cups of water**: The base for your ginger water.
– **1 tablespoon of honey (optional)**: Adds a touch of natural sweetness if desired. Honey also has its own health benefits, including soothing a sore throat.
– **1 tablespoon of lemon juice (optional)**: A splash of fresh lemon juice enhances the flavor and adds an extra boost of vitamin C, which supports your immune system.
